Studio Wok converts abandoned electrical cabin into minimalist artist residency

Deezen

Architecture office Studio Wok has transformed a disused technical building at QuadroDesign 's headquarters in northern Italy into an artist residency, with living and sleeping areas accommodated in its unusually shaped roof. Milan-based Studio Wok redesigned the headquarters for tapware brand QuadroDesign in 2022 and was subsequently asked to oversee this second phase, overhauling an area of the surrounding grounds.

OMA's CCTV Headquarters was the most significant building of 2012

Deezen

Continuing our 21st-Century Architecture: 25 Years 25 Buildings series, we take a look at OMA 's CCTV Headquarters in Beijing , an iconic symbol of China 's construction boom. OMA 's skyscraper was among the first wave of high-profile buildings designed by Europe's top architects as China announced its presence as an economic and construction powerhouse.
